Abstract
The original 505 Jet Ranger X prototype used a simple hard-mounted focal pylon to attach the transmission to the airframe. In developmental flight tests, the design resulted in 2/rev vibration levels that exceeded program objectives for ride quality in high speed forward flight. To address the vibration levels, a LIVE pylon mount was designed over a 4-month period to serve as a drop-in replacement with minimal impact to existing systems. An overview of the rapid design process is presented with supporting analysis and test data that led to its incorporation on the aircraft. The LIVE pylon design cut the vertical 2/rev vibrations in half, without negatively impacting existing structures, drive systems, flight controls, or handling qualities. The LIVE pylon mount is part of the Bell 505 Type Design that was certified in December 2016.
